### Event not validating against schema

Check the Ridgeline schema registry first. Fetch the subject's latest version; mismatched field ordering is usually the culprit. If the producer pinned an old schema ID, bump it and redeploy. Do not edit schemas in place — register a new version. Compatibility mode is BACKWARD for all subjects. To query the registry's staging instance, use the token below.

session JWT of yawep-yawep = eyJhbGciOiJIUzI1NiIsInR5cCI6IkpXVCJ9.eyJzdWIiOiI3pWF3_In0.aXYsHiog

**TICKET-4471: Markprose vault locked, pipeline blocked**

The Markprose render pipeline can't pull sanitizer configs because the Quillgate vault auto-locked after three failed agent attempts. All external plugin builds are queued until unlock. Don't retry auth — it extends the lockout. Ops has approved emergency recovery for plugin authors blocked more than two hours. Use the recovery passphrase below to unlock Quillgate and resume rendering.

recovery phrase for fawif-tajeg: norael-aldmir-casir-brivan-ulaion

**Vendor note: Inkmill markdown pipeline**

Rendering for Parchway docs is outsourced to Inkmill under an annual contract, renewing each March. They handle sanitization and PDF export; we own the upload queue. SLA: 4-hour response on rendering failures. Escalate only after two failed retries. Their support desk is reachable at the address below.

billing contact of hahaf-baguf = zorael.tammir.jorius@sivrelhq.internal

Ticket: drift in the Mirewood orphaned-resource sweeper. Prod sweeper config no longer matches the repo baseline — someone bumped the retention window by hand during the March incident and never backported it. Result: orphaned volumes in the Tallis region survive two extra cycles and inflate storage costs. Fix is to reconcile prod against source and re-enable drift alerts. For reference, the live sweeper configuration as read today is below.

deployment values, fafog-yahag:
[druath]
port = 3000
region = west-3
host = druath.norvatech.test
team = novvan
timeout_ms = 2000
retries = 2